1. WordNet® 3.0 (2006)
anguished
    adj 1: experiencing intense pain especially mental pain; "an
           anguished conscience"; "a small tormented schoolboy"; "a
           tortured witness to another's humiliation" [syn:
           anguished, tormented, tortured]

2. The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
anguished \anguished\ adj. [p. p. from anguish.]
   suffering anguish; experiencing extreme pain, distress, or
   anxiety

   Syn: suffering, tormented
        [WordNet 1.5]
